Message wasn't too bad, you could create an "A/C" system for the intake air - the evap core could be maintained at ~ 35°F for as long as you need it. Air path restriction through an evaporator core would present a problem though.

But I figured you could use a smaller A/C compressor to reduce weight/drag to get over the parasitic loss....but in the end, I don't know if the power increase would be enough to overcome the weight and power loss of the A/C system.
